Central America And The Caribbean - Emissions - CH4 - Energy

Central America and the Caribbean (1000 metric tons of CO2 equivalent in 2020)

Trinidad and Tobago is the top country by the emissions of CH4 from energy among 20 countries. As of 2020, the emissions of CH4 from energy in Trinidad and Tobago was 5,446.1 1000 metric tons of CO2 equivalent. The top 5 countries also includes Guatemala, Haiti, Honduras, and Cuba.
